Year: 1988
Runtime: 94 mins
Language: English
Director: Ed Hunt
Dr. Blake hosts the television program “Independent Thinkers,” a self‑help/religious show that resembles Scientology. Unbeknownst to viewers, he partners with an alien entity he dubs The Brain, using it to brainwash participants and seize control. The only obstacle to his plan for world domination is a brilliant yet troubled high‑school student who loves pulling pranks and decides to fight back.
